Accountant

Florida, West palm beach, 33401 West palm beach USA
Aplica ya

Prestigious Multi State Creditor Rights Firm

The Staff Accountant is a key position within the Finance and Accounting Team. The Staff Accountant will support the Financial Reporting and Accounting teams to deliver accurate accounting and financial information to ensure sound financial and operations decisions.

Our company maintains a collegial work environment that prioritizes internal promotion, training, and professional development. We strive to see our employees grow! As our team-members progress and demonstrate a consistent ability to meet performance standards, promotional opportunities become available.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ities:

Ensure an accurate monthly close process by reviewing, analyzing, and reporting on movements and significant transactions;

Ensure integrity of transactions and data and it’s reflection on the company's financials;

Support in the preparation of timely and accurate monthly accrual and cash statements;

Perform detail accounting analysis & process related Journal Entries related to General Ledger Accounts;

Ensure compliance with all deliverable due dates and timelines for recurring, Client and ad hoc reporting;

Complete monthly/weekly account allocations and reconciliations;

Other responsibilities and special projects as assigned and modified at company’s discretion.

Knowledge, Skills, & Abilities:

o Driven to deliver, create and maintain accurate, thorough and complete accounting information, and improve accounting and reporting processes;

o Communicate effectively with upper management, and across all teams within the organization;

o Strong working knowledge of Accounting packages and data analysis and reporting tools - Excel (Advanced);

o Strong understanding of P&L, Balance Sheet and Cash Flow Statements, and their interrelation;

o Ability to multi task critical functions and handle multiple projects in a fast-paced environment;

o Ability to work independently and make sound decisions while meeting time sensitive deadlines;

o Ability to work at an appropriate level of detail;

o Ability to challenge the status quo, and drive, change and deliver results;

o Excellent Financial presentation and Oral & Written communication skills.

Required Education/Experience:

o Bachelor’s degree from an accredited institution in accounting, finance, business, or a related field;

o 2 years of progressive Accounting and Financial Reporting experience required;

o Advanced Excel skills is essential;

o Strong ability to adapt to Accounting S/W packages.
